Comes with Audacity software, which helps convert your casette tapes to mp3 files (or AIFF, or Ogg Vorbis, if you prefer). You can record a whole side of a tape in one go, and then easily chop it up in its separate tracks if you like. I am not a techie and found it all quite easy to work. Sometimes I had a strong buzz coming in over an otherwise clean tape; stop the machine, switch it all off and on again, and it is fine again. Not quite sure which caused this, not dirty heads (I cleaned these a few times with proper cleaning solution) not a bad lead connection. Anyway, I converted all my tapes to my satisfaction; just as I did earlier with all my records, using an ION record deck. A useful machine!
